During the week we found a large beetle in the car park and we wondered what it was called. We carefully scooped it up into a cup because we didn't know if it would sting us and we didn't want to hurt it. We looked in a book and found out that it was a Great Diving Beetle. We looked at the colour and the patterns to make sure. Then we let it go. We talked about the fact that we can look on the internet and in books to find out information.
